The candidate must manually shape and form products into a specified shape.

The candidate must:

follow the requirements of the work instruction

work to production speed

correctly fill a range of product lines in terms of:

casing

clips

length

tension

weight

shape and form a range of products to product specifications, workplace, hygiene and sanitation, QA and customer requirements

demonstrate operation, adjustments and actions of filling machine to address faults

operate a metal detector if a detector is included in the operation

identify, remove and rectify faulty product

identify defects in natural casings

clean equipment according to workplace requirements

apply relevant communication and mathematical skills

explain filling to required product specifications for a variety of products

apply relevant workplace health and safety, and regulatory requirements

The candidate must demonstrate a basic factual, technical and procedural knowledge of:

hygiene requirements for forming products

filling to required product specifications for a variety of products

how and why products must be formed and shaped

possible faults in skins and their effect on the product

procedures for dealing with waste product and broken casings

relevant workplace health and safety, and regulatory requirements
